Description
A rare antique English solid silver novelty Miniature Wheelbarrow having pierced sides and a rotating wheel – possibly a BonBon sweet dish /Trinket Dish
Circa Birmingham 1908 – Makers Marks for Charles S Green & Co
Good Condition
4.75 inches (12cm) width X 2.75 inches (7cm) depth X 2 inches (5cm) height approx
Charles S Green & Co,
Business was established in 1905 by Charles S. Green, son and brother of the managers of Charles Green & Son. He was assisted in the business by his wife Winifred, a talented artist who designed all of the firm’s early patterns. The firm moved in 1907 to Cogent Works, 54 St. Paul’s Square and in 1982 to a new factory at Lionel Street, Birmingham.
